The Children’s Specialty Hospital for Short-Term Assessment and Treatment of Complex Conditions

In 2024, The Center for Discovery will open a world-class Children’s Specialty Hospital to provide short-term, inpatient assessment and treatment – with the goal of better diagnosing underlying problems that affect behavior and learning in individuals with autism and other conditions. Improved understanding of underlying physiological, medical, and mental health challenges will lead to more targeted treatments and interventions, all to enable children and adolescents to remain at home, in school, and integrated in the community.

The Children’s Specialty Hospital will conduct comprehensive medical, behavioral, and clinical assessments over a maximum of six months. Staff will engage parents, caregivers, and school district personnel as partners in the process.

The Children’s Specialty Hospital will significantly advance the continuum of services in New York State – and provide a new model of care both nationally and internationally that has the potential to make a profound impact.
